Representations and Warranties Contained in the Trust Loan Purchase Agreement. (a) Upon discovery by any party hereto of (i) a Material Breach of any representation and warranty set forth in Exhibit A to the Trust Loan Purchase Agreement, which representation and warranty was made by the Trust Loan Seller in the Trust Loan Purchase Agreement and has been assigned to the Trustee pursuant to Section 2.1 hereof, or (ii) a Material Document Defect, such Person shall give prompt notice thereof to the other parties hereto and the Companion Loan Holders, and upon receipt or delivery, as applicable, of such notice the Special Servicer shall use commercially reasonable efforts to cause the Trust Loan Seller, to the extent obligated to do so under the Trust Loan Purchase Agreement, to cure such default or defect or repurchase the Trust Loan under the terms of and within the time period specified by the Trust Loan Purchase Agreement, it being understood and agreed that none of such Persons has an obligation to conduct any investigation with respect to such matters. It is understood and agreed that the obligations of the Trust Loan Seller referred to in this Section 2.6(a) shall be the sole remedies available to the Certificateholders or the Trustee respecting a Material Breach of any representation and warranty made by the Trust Loan Seller or a Material Document Defect.
